This state-of-the-art stadium with an 80,000 seating capacity will become the centrepiece of Lusail City and add a new page to Qatar’s memory. Pinnacle Infotech is proud to be involved in the construction process. Our 80 BIM professionals worked on the project from July to August 2017. It was a stadium project, including very challenging steel, concrete, and precast configuration. By delivering an accurate BIM model, our internal team ensured a flawless visualization of constructability and helped the client avoid major project setbacks.

Solutions

 

  • Complex mesh elements from the triangulation of a selected set of points were used to compute 3D volume elements of various bulk materials in constructing this iconic stadium in Qatar.
  • The implementation of Laser scanning throughout the project for point-to-point inspections was an innovative step in Lusail Stadium. We used the Autodesk Recap.
  • To accommodate the movements and tolerance during installation, we have implemented a custom-made workflow by collecting a laser scan reality model as a representation of the as-built conditions model is compared against the theoretical BIM design models using Autodesk Recap, Autodesk Navisworks, and cloud compare solutions.
  • Pinnacle generated accurate Quantity Takeoff reports from the coordinated 3D model of Lusail Stadium, empowering the project team to make informed procurement estimations & decisions.
  • Lusail Stadium is a challenging configuration of steel, concrete, and precast. After coordination, Pinnacle re-designed the MEP risers and their support systems for prefabricated installation
  • Pinnacle collected a total of 2140 As-Built Scans using a Faro Focus S 150 Scanner to monitor project progress, productivity, & coordination issues
  • We performed efficient logistics planning, tower crane coordination, and MEP equipment lifting strategy for seamless site coordination

Pinnacle used Revit™ with BIM interoperability tools and in-house automation add-ins to generate unique IDs for all 220,000+ Assets in our LOD 500 intelligent model.

 

Pinnacle’s Value Addition for Lusail Stadium Project

(A) Resource Planning and Cost Saving at Construction Job Site

Our team effectively collaborated with other vendors and general contractors on the Project, producing 2,000 drawings per month at peak times. The progress at the site included:

  • 2000 CUM of concrete casting/day
  • 300 SQFT of Brickwork/day
  • 12,500 Cum precast Bowl
  • 56,000Sqm World's largest cable and membrane structure
  • 33 KM Structural High Strength Tension Cabling
  • 35,000 TON Composite Structural Steel
  • 65,000 SQM Façade Panels

PiVDC Tools Used in Lusail Stadium Project

While providing the BIM solutions on this iconic project, Pinnacle Infotech used PiVDC tools to update parameter values of multiple elements, divide elements into smaller parts, join or offset factors at different elevations, manage gaps between pipes or ducts, create section boxes, place multiple hangers automatically, and map properties of one Revit element to another. These tools have significantly improved the efficiency and accuracy of the Lusail Stadium, reducing the time required for modeling and increasing the quality of the final product.
